Just take a multiclass ranger/cleric. I can understand taking a high dc with fighters so as to get Grandmastery, but rangers can only get 2 PP in each weapon anyway. It would give you guaranteed decent level clerical spells at every stage of the game.

Yes, that's Bandoth. He also sells scrolls. You can also kill him for a little extra xp after the quest. He's pretty surly, so it's easy to pick a fight.

The last three (of four) quest items for the gardener in the SH aren't found until Lower Dorns, so you probably wouldn't be at a point to fulfill that quest yet anyway.

DE lvl 3 is a good place to test out spells, as well. Experience in XP camping has helped me to almost exactly "eyeball" area of effect spells.

Funny, I went through DE lvl 3 on HoF mode a couple weeks ago, and it was probably even easier XP for me than it is for you. My lvl 28 paladin has about 75% of the kills on HoF from walking through the Vale of Shadows and DE lvl 3 exploding all the undead with awesome turning power.

Yes, TOTAL = about 650K for a normal game with no camping; as in about 108K per character in a party of 6. Mystique, the character I used to measure this, had 110K at the end of DE. She missed about 4 or 5 nice fights on the last DE level (she did NOT miss the final battle), which was partially offset by maybe 5 camping-induced encounters on DE1 (party was trying to regain spells and HP). The party camped on DE3 long enough to get 10K XP per character, to level the "hireling" Thief whom I needed for the last level of DE. But the hireling was using Mystiques' party slot; so her numbers were not skewed by this exercise.
